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05 608501 66 7901155 6578096058
767 59858587412 4952453188
767 59858587412 4952453188
0025373037 68 71
All about undefined
Interested in learning more?
767 59858587412 4952453188
0025373037 68 71
See more
0615129 5048369
18766344 10653 35668552 3975276522
See more
203728 59509633073 9944527754
924125402 7778 942 7548
See more